**Action Item 5: Enforce image size budget in CI**

The Corvase outage traced back to a bloated base image that pushed deploy times past the rollout window. We will add a CI gate failing any image over 400 MB and migrate remaining services to the slim base. The migration checklist is on the internal page.

runbook for badug-kadup: https://confluence.zemvarlabs.internal/projects/browse/display/projects/bd1b

## Feedcheck Environments

Feedcheck, our podcast feed validator, runs in three environments: dev, staging, and prod. Dev validates against a fixture set of malformed feeds; staging pulls a sampled slice of real traffic; prod handles full load with rate limiting enabled. Reviewers should verify changes against staging before approval, since dev skips the enclosure-size checks. Each environment boots with its own copy of these values.

service settings:
[casax]
port = 6379
team = rusir
host = casax.zemvarhq.corp
region = outer-4
access_code = ac_9808ce
timeout_ms = 1500

Ticket FW-2281: Signature check failing on the Lumenbird firmware update channel. Since Tuesday, devices on the beta ring reject the 4.2.1 image with SIG_MISMATCH. Turns out the build box picked up the old staging cert after the Harkwell migration, so everything signed since Monday is bad. Rolled affected devices back to 4.2.0, no bricks so far. Fix is to re-sign with the current release key and republish. For anyone verifying locally before the sync, the correct signing key is below.

deploy key for bawig-tajop: bky9_PQ3GVoQw1

Handover: Flagwright rollout framework. Percentage ramps are computed server-side in the Cadence service; client SDKs only cache evaluations for 30 seconds, so stale-flag bugs should be rare. I've left the kill-switch path untested under partition — please review that branch carefully before approving. Mira owns the dashboard work next sprint. Full rollout checklist and edge cases are documented on the internal page below.

dashboard of yafog-fajof = https://jira.tolvaqsys.internal/pages/pages/projects/49fe21c4